Papeete is the largest city in and capital of French Polynesia. It is on the island of Tahiti.

EAT
You can go broke eating in this town. There are some fine restaurants but expect to pay US$30 for a hamburger.
There are a lot of midrange places where you can expect to pay US$25-30 for your whole meal. French is well represented here. There is also a conveyor belt sushi place that's very good, and the chefs are quite friendly there.
The best deal in town is the food trucks that set up shop every evening in the big square in the waterfront park. Every day they begin setting up around dusk. Chinese, French, and Tahitian cuisine are all well represented. You can get chow mein, poisson cru, crepes, ice cream, and of course this is France so everything comes with bread. Expect to pay about US$15 for your whole meal.
